Title: Innovative Contributions of Giorgio Attardo in Tau Imaging
Introduction
Giorgio Attardo, an inventive mind based in Bryn Mawr, Pennsylvania, has made significant strides in the field of medical imaging. He is recognized for his innovative work on azetidine derivatives which serve crucial applications in tau imaging, a vital process for understanding neurodegenerative diseases.
Latest Patents
Giorgio Attardo holds a patent for "Azetidine derivatives for tau imaging." This invention encompasses a novel compound with specific formulas, methods for synthesizing this compound, and methodologies for utilizing it in tau imaging. Additionally, he has developed formulations for tau imaging that enhance the diagnostic capabilities for conditions related to tau proteins.
